Touring cycling in Deggendorf offers diverse landscapes across Bavaria's fertile plains and the foothills of the Bavarian Forest. The region is characterized by significant riverine scenery, including the Danube and Isar rivers, which provide extensive flat sections suitable for cycling. A well-developed cycling infrastructure supports a variety of routes, from riverside paths to trails venturing into the gentle hills surrounding the area.

The Hilgartsberg is primarily known for the castle ruins of the same name, which majestically perch on a steep slope above the Danube in the Lower Bavarian market town of Hofkirchen (Passau district). It is considered one of the most historic sites in the region.

In the middle of the idyllic landscape, gigantic concrete pillars rise to great heights (up to 99 meters) to support the highway. Impressive! It's worth taking a few minutes to admire the structure, which was built in 1978.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many touring cycling routes are available in Deggendorf?

Deggendorf offers a wide variety of touring cycling routes, with over 1200 options available. These routes cater to all skill levels, including over 500 easy routes, more than 440 moderate routes, and over 270 challenging routes for experienced cyclists.

What kind of terrain can I expect on touring cycling routes in Deggendorf?

The terrain in Deggendorf is quite diverse, ranging from flat, extensive sections along the Danube and Isar rivers to gentle hills in the foothills of the Bavarian Forest. You'll find well-developed cycling infrastructure, including dedicated cycleways, quiet roads, and tracks, with some routes venturing into dense woodlands and open meadows.

What natural features or landmarks can I see along the touring cycling routes?

Deggendorf's touring cycling routes offer access to a wealth of natural beauty and landmarks. You can explore the unique wetland nature reserve at the confluence of the Danube and Isar rivers, or cycle through the Klausenstein Summit Cross area. The region also features serene lakes like Lake Deggendorf and hills offering panoramic views, such as the Rauher Kulm — Summit & Panoramic Viewpoint or Großer Büchelstein summit cross and panoramic view.

Are there any castles or historic sites accessible by touring bike in Deggendorf?

Yes, several historic sites and castles are within cycling distance. You can discover the Winzer Castle Ruins 🏰, Egg Castle, or Offenberg Castle. The Natternberg Castle Ruins and Himmelberg Castle also offer interesting stops for history enthusiasts.

What is the best time of year for touring cycling in Deggendorf?

The spring, summer, and early autumn months are generally the best for touring cycling in Deggendorf, offering pleasant weather to enjoy the riverine landscapes and the foothills of the Bavarian Forest. During these seasons, the paths are clear, and the natural beauty is at its peak.

Are there challenging touring cycling routes for experienced cyclists?

Yes, for experienced cyclists seeking a challenge, Deggendorf provides difficult routes with varied terrain and significant distances. The Auenlandrunde - Experience cycling tours in the Bavarian Golf and Thermal Spa Region is a difficult 119.2 km path traversing diverse landscapes. Another demanding option is the Rail Trail Near Stolzing – Ilz Railway Bridge, Kalteneck loop from Osterhofen (Niederbay), a 94.3 km route with significant elevation gain.

Are there any long-distance cycle paths that pass through Deggendorf?

Yes, Deggendorf is a key point on some of Europe's most famous long-distance cycle paths. The renowned Danube Cycle Path runs directly through the town, offering magnificent views along the Danube River. The Isar Cycle Path also winds through idyllic river landscapes, with its confluence with the Danube near Deggendorf being a notable nature reserve.

Is public transport available to access touring cycling routes in Deggendorf?

Deggendorf is well-connected by public transport, making it convenient to access various starting points for touring cycling routes. The main train station (Deggendorf Hbf) serves as a hub, and local bus services can also help reach trailheads further afield. Many routes, like the Basilica of Niederaltaich – Danube Promenade Deggendorf loop from Moos, are easily accessible from towns with public transport connections.
